The word terrapin is rooted in the language of native peoples of north america. It is derived from torope, which comes from the southern algonquin, and more specifically, from the long-extinct powhatan tongue. Twenty thousand years ago, ice sheets, some a mile thick, extended across north america as far south as modern-day illinois. With so much of the world’s water captured in these massive ice sheets, global sea levels were much lower, and a land bridge connected asia and north america across the bering strait.

American notes for general circulation is a travelogue by charles dickens detailing his trip to north america from january to june 1842. While there he acted as a critical observer of north american society, almost as if returning a status report on their progress.
